The rural roads and frequent agricultural activity in the Deering area can lead to suspension issues, wheel alignment problems from potholes, and clogged air filters from dust. Additionally, the humid Southeast Missouri climate can accelerate corrosion and battery degradation, making electrical system checks important.
For most rout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and non-warranty repairs, a local Deering-area general repair shop is typically more convenient and cost-effective. Dealerships are often necessary for complex manufacturer-specific diagnostics or recall work, which may require a trip to Poplar Bluff or Cape Girardeau.
Pricing is competitive with the wider Southeast Missouri region. A conventional oil change typically ranges from $35-$50, while brake pad replacement for one axle generally costs between $150-$300 per axle, depending on the vehicle. Always request a detailed written estimate before work begins.
